Gloucester School Board Reviews New Programs and Teacher Compensation

The Gloucester County School Board met Wednesday to review proposed programs for middle and high school students and discuss employee compensation. Plans include career investigations for sixth graders, advanced science courses for sixth and seventh graders, Criminal Justice II for upperclassmen, and Techniques of Dance for performing arts students. Former Correctional Officer Granted Bond in Essex Assault Case

26 year old Kalib Jamaal Rich of Colonial Beach was granted a $25,000 secured bond in Essex County Circuit Court. Rich faces misdemeanor assault and battery charges involving Akeem Tavon Grant and felony assault and battery against a law enforcement officer following a November 27 custody dispute in Tappahannock. Mathews School Board Reviews Budget Consolidation

The Mathews County School Board met earlier this week, to begin the 2026-2027 budget process, discuss consolidating Mathews Elementary and Thomas Hunter Middle School into a single pre-K through seventh grade school, and review new state school performance data. Parents raised concerns about special education support at the elementary school.

Caroling by Kayaks Scheduled for Put-In Creek Saturday Night

Kayakers will take to Put-In Creek Saturday evening for a holiday caroling event, weather permitting. Launching from the Put-In Creek Kayak Launch at Mathews Court House at 6 p.m., participants will paddle along the creek, stopping at docks to sing Christmas carols. Two Rape Cases Concluded in Middlesex Circuit Court

Middlesex County Circuit Court recently resolved two high-profile rape cases. 46 year old Ricky Layne Jenkins of Saluda, was found guilty of rape following a Dec. 9-10 trial and remains held without bail, with sentencing set for Feb. 18th. Middlesex County Schools Face $163,685 State Funding Shortfall

Middlesex County Public Schools will lose an estimated $163,685 in state education funds due to lower than expected student enrollment. Officials say funding is based on average daily membership, and the revised figure of 1,130 students reduces state revenue for the year.
